A resume for an electrical professional should clearly articulate the candidate’s abilities and experience. This involves listing specific competencies relevant to electrical work, such as knowledge of wiring systems, proficiency with diagnostic tools, and experience with various electrical codes. For example, listing experience with conduit bending or control panel wiring showcases specific expertise. Quantifiable achievements, like “Reduced electrical system failures by 15%,” provide concrete evidence of capability.

3. Safety Consciousness
Safety consciousness is paramount in electrical work, making it a critical skill for any electrician. Demonstrating a commitment to safety on a resume is essential for securing employment. Employers prioritize candidates who understand and adhere to safety regulations, minimizing risk to themselves, colleagues, and the public.
-
Regulatory Compliance
Understanding and adhering to relevant safety regulations, such as OSHA guidelines and the National Electrical Code (NEC), is fundamental. This includes proper lockout/tagout procedures, wearing appropriate personal protective equipment (PPE), and maintaining a safe work environment. Listing specific safety certifications, such as OSHA 10 or 30, demonstrates a commitment to safety practices and strengthens a resume.
-
Risk Assessment
Electricians must possess the ability to identify potential hazards and assess risks before commencing work. This involves analyzing electrical systems, recognizing potential dangers, and implementing appropriate safety measures. Including examples of proactive safety measures taken in previous roles, like “Implemented a new lockout/tagout procedure that reduced incidents by 20%,” showcases this crucial skill.
-
Emergency Response
Knowing how to respond effectively in emergencies is crucial. This includes administering first aid, utilizing fire extinguishers, and implementing emergency shutdown procedures. Highlighting experience with emergency response protocols or relevant training, like CPR/First Aid certification, further demonstrates a commitment to safety.
-
Continuous Learning
Electrical safety standards and regulations evolve. Demonstrating a commitment to ongoing learning and staying updated with the latest safety practices is highly valued. Mentioning participation in safety training programs or memberships in professional organizations focused on safety reinforces a proactive approach to safety consciousness.

5. Code Compliance
Code compliance is a non-negotiable aspect of electrical work, directly impacting safety and functionality. Its importance for electricians translates into a crucial resume element. Demonstrated understanding and adherence to relevant electrical codes, such as the National Electrical Code (NEC) in the United States, or other regional and international standards, signals professionalism and competency. This knowledge ensures installations meet safety standards, minimizing hazards like fire and electrocution. For example, proper grounding and bonding techniques, dictated by code, are essential for preventing electrical shocks. Similarly, adherence to conduit fill capacity regulations ensures adequate heat dissipation, preventing overheating and potential fire hazards. Listing specific code familiarity on a resume, for example, “Proficient in NEC 2020,” immediately communicates an electrician’s commitment to safe and compliant installations.
Practical implications of code compliance extend beyond immediate safety concerns. Compliance ensures the long-term functionality and reliability of electrical systems. Adhering to wire sizing and overcurrent protection requirements, for instance, prevents premature equipment failure and ensures the system operates within safe parameters. This understanding translates into cost savings through preventative maintenance and reduced downtime. For employers, hiring electricians with demonstrable code compliance knowledge minimizes liability and ensures adherence to legal requirements. Including quantifiable achievements related to code compliance, such as “Successfully implemented electrical system upgrades in compliance with NEC 2020,” further strengthens a resume by demonstrating practical application of this knowledge.

6. Troubleshooting Expertise
Troubleshooting expertise is a critical skill for electricians, making it a significant component of a strong resume. Electrical systems can malfunction due to various factors, requiring a systematic approach to identify and resolve issues. This expertise encompasses a combination of technical knowledge, analytical skills, and practical experience. A proficient troubleshooter possesses a deep understanding of electrical theory, circuit analysis, and the function of various components. This foundational knowledge enables systematic diagnosis, isolating the root cause of faults efficiently. The ability to interpret wiring diagrams, analyze test results from multimeters or other diagnostic tools, and deduce the source of malfunctions is essential for effective troubleshooting. Listing specific troubleshooting experience on a resume, such as “Expertise in troubleshooting industrial control systems,” demonstrates practical application of this skill and strengthens a candidate’s profile.
Real-world scenarios highlight the practical significance of troubleshooting expertise. Consider a malfunctioning lighting circuit in a commercial building. A skilled troubleshooter would systematically check the circuit breaker, wiring, switches, and fixtures to identify the fault. This might involve using a multimeter to test voltage and continuity, isolating the problem area efficiently. In another scenario, an industrial electrician might encounter a complex motor control system experiencing intermittent failures. Troubleshooting this issue requires expertise in programmable logic controllers (PLCs), variable frequency drives (VFDs), and other specialized equipment. Successfully diagnosing and resolving such complex issues demonstrates a high level of troubleshooting proficiency, a valuable asset for any employer. Providing quantifiable examples on a resume, such as “Reduced downtime by 20% through efficient troubleshooting of motor control systems,” further substantiates this expertise.

7. Blueprint Reading
Blueprint reading is a fundamental skill for electricians, directly impacting their ability to interpret technical drawings and translate them into functional electrical systems. This skill is crucial for understanding the scope and requirements of a project, enabling accurate installations and adherence to design specifications. Blueprints provide a visual representation of the electrical system, including the location of outlets, fixtures, wiring pathways, and equipment. Competent blueprint reading enables electricians to visualize the completed project, anticipate potential challenges, and plan their work effectively. This understanding minimizes errors, reduces rework, and ensures efficient project execution. A resume that highlights blueprint reading proficiency signals a candidate’s ability to work independently and follow complex instructions, valuable assets in the electrical field. For example, an electrician tasked with wiring a new commercial building relies on blueprints to determine the location of electrical panels, the routing of conduits, and the placement of lighting fixtures. Accurate interpretation of these plans is essential for a successful and code-compliant installation.
Practical applications of blueprint reading extend beyond basic installations. In renovation projects, electricians often encounter existing wiring and systems that may not be fully documented. Blueprint reading skills, combined with on-site assessment, allow for accurate identification of existing circuits, minimizing the risk of accidental damage or disruption during upgrades. Furthermore, in industrial settings, blueprints often depict complex control systems, requiring a higher level of interpretation. Understanding these schematics is crucial for troubleshooting, maintenance, and modifications to these systems. An electrician working on a manufacturing plant’s automated assembly line, for example, needs to interpret complex electrical diagrams to diagnose faults and implement repairs effectively. This ability to understand and apply complex technical drawings demonstrates a higher level of skill and professionalism.

Frequently Asked Questions
This section addresses common inquiries regarding the effective presentation of electrician skills on a resume.
Question 1: How can quantifiable achievements be incorporated into a resume?
Quantifiable achievements provide concrete evidence of skills and contributions. Instead of simply listing “Troubleshooting skills,” one might state “Reduced equipment downtime by 15% through proactive troubleshooting and preventative maintenance.” This approach demonstrates tangible impact and strengthens resume impact.
Question 2: What are the most important skills to highlight for entry-level electricians?
Entry-level resumes should emphasize foundational skills like code compliance (e.g., NEC), safety practices (e.g., OSHA 10 certification), and core electrical knowledge (e.g., circuit wiring, conduit bending). Demonstrated aptitude for learning and adherence to safety protocols are highly valued.
Question 3: How should experience with different electrical specializations be presented?
Tailor the resume to the target job description. If applying for an industrial electrician role, highlight experience with industrial control systems, high-voltage equipment, and relevant safety protocols. For residential roles, emphasize experience with residential wiring practices, code compliance, and customer interaction.
Question 4: What is the best way to describe software proficiency relevant to electrical work?
List specific software applications and the level of proficiency. For example, “Proficient in AutoCAD for electrical drafting” or “Experienced with ETAP for power system analysis” clearly communicates relevant technical skills.
Question 5: How can career progression be demonstrated on a resume?
Present work history chronologically, highlighting increasing responsibilities and achievements. Use action verbs to describe accomplishments and quantify contributions whenever possible, demonstrating growth and professional development within the electrical field.
Question 6: How important are certifications for showcasing skills on a resume?
Certifications provide verifiable evidence of specialized training and expertise. Listing relevant certifications, such as journeyman electrician licenses, OSHA certifications, or manufacturer-specific training credentials, strengthens a resume and demonstrates commitment to professional development.

Tips for Showcasing Electrical Expertise on a Resume
This section provides practical guidance for effectively presenting electrical qualifications on a resume, maximizing impact and attracting potential employers.
Tip 1: Prioritize Relevant Skills: Focus on skills directly applicable to the target job description. Tailor the resume to each specific application, highlighting the most relevant competencies. Generic resumes lack impact. Researching the specific requirements of each position ensures the most pertinent skills are prominently featured.
Tip 2: Quantify Achievements: Numbers speak volumes. Quantifying accomplishments demonstrates tangible impact. Instead of stating “Improved electrical system efficiency,” provide specifics: “Reduced energy consumption by 10% through strategic system upgrades.” This data-driven approach adds credibility and strengthens the resume.
Tip 3: Showcase Safety Consciousness: Emphasize commitment to safety by highlighting relevant certifications (e.g., OSHA 30) and experience with safety protocols (e.g., Lockout/Tagout). This demonstrates responsibility and professionalism, essential qualities in the electrical field.
Tip 4: Highlight Technical Proficiency: Clearly articulate technical skills, using industry-specific terminology. List proficiency with relevant software, equipment, and tools. Specificity demonstrates expertise. For example, instead of “Familiar with electrical systems,” state “Proficient in troubleshooting PLC-based control systems.”
Tip 5: Demonstrate Problem-Solving Abilities: Provide examples of how problem-solving skills have been applied in previous roles. Describe challenges encountered and the solutions implemented. This showcases analytical thinking and practical application of electrical knowledge. Illustrative examples add depth and context.
Tip 6: Structure for Clarity: Organize the resume logically, using clear headings and bullet points. A well-structured resume facilitates easy navigation and allows potential employers to quickly assess qualifications. Consistency in formatting enhances readability and professionalism.
Tip 7: Proofread Meticulously: Errors undermine credibility. Thoroughly proofread the resume for grammatical errors, typos, and inconsistencies. Attention to detail reflects professionalism and a commitment to quality, essential attributes in the electrical field.
